Patent number: 12014017Abstract: In the present invention a detection unit of a touch panel has sensor electrodes and a plurality of lead-out wires connected to the sensor electrodes. Each lead-out wire is provided with a wiring main section. The sensor electrodes are provided with a plurality of electrode main sections and a plurality of connection sections. The wiring main sections and electrode main sections are formed by repeatedly arranging side by side, in a first direction, unit patterns having a prescribed shape. In a second direction two adjacent electrode main sections are connected to each other by at least one connection section. Connections sections which are near to each other in the second direction are in different positions in the first direction.Type: GrantFiled: October 12, 2020Date of Patent: June 18, 2024Assignee: Japan Aviation Electronics Industry, LimitedInventors: Yuji Kitamura, Makoto Danno, Joji Akizuki

Patent number: 11923174Abstract: A plasma processing system includes a plasma processing apparatus including a processing container that accommodates a substrate, and configured to perform a plasma processing on the substrate by generating a plasma in the processing container; and a control device configured to control the plasma processing apparatus. The control device collects a measurement value indicating a matching state of impedance between a power supply and the plasma; specifies a point corresponding to a value of the variables that maximizes a gradient of change of the measurement value with respect to a vector; specifies a point farther from the matching point than the passing point on a straight line; and ignites the plasma in the plasma processing apparatus by controlling each variable so that the measurement value changes from the starting point toward the matching point along the straight line.Type: GrantFiled: August 28, 2020Date of Patent: March 5, 2024Assignee: TOKYO ELECTRON LIMITEDInventor: Yuji Kitamura

Publication number: 20220197433Abstract: A touch panel includes an electrode layer made of a conductive mesh, and provided with a first electrode, a second electrode, and a dummy electrode. The first electrode has a first facing part, which is formed in a first region. The second electrode has a second facing part, which is formed in a second region. The first and second facing parts face each other and are separated from each other in a predetermined direction. The dummy electrode has an interposition part located at least partially between the first and second facing parts. The interposition part is formed in a dummy region, which has a first end portion region and a second end portion region as both end regions in a predetermined direction. The first region and the first end portion region overlap each other, and the second region and the second end portion region overlap each other.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 9, 2020Publication date: June 23, 2022Applicant: JAPAN AVIATION ELECTRONICS INDUSTRY, LIMITEDInventors: Makoto DANNO, Yuji KITAMURA, Joji AKIZUKI

Publication number: 20210159054Abstract: A gas supply system is connected between at least one gas source and a chamber having a first and a second gas inlet. The gas supply system includes a flow adjusting unit including flow adjusting lines, each including a pair of a first line and a second line. The first line connects the at least one gas source and the first gas inlet and has a first valve and a first orifice, the second line connects the at least one gas source and the second gas inlet and has a second valve and a second orifice, and the first orifice and the second orifice in each of the flow adjusting lines have the same size. The gas supply system further includes at least one control unit configured to control an opening/closing of the first valve and an opening/closing of the second valve in each of the flow adjusting lines.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 11, 2020Publication date: May 27, 2021Applicant: TOKYO ELECTRON LIMITEDInventors: Hwajun JUNG, Yuji KITAMURA

Patent number: 10733962Abstract: An image generation device includes: a rasterizing portion generating, according string data, an element-blank image including a first element image indicating a first-type string element of a string and a blank image indicating a blank; an embedding portion identifying and embedding a second element image indicating a second-type string element of the string in the blank image; a first data storage portion in which a first data group used to generate the first element image is stored; and a second data storage portion in which a second data group including an image to be embedded as the second element image is stored. The rasterizing portion generates the first element image based on the first data group, and generates the blank image at a position where the second element image is to be embedded by identifying an embedding position of the second element image.Type: GrantFiled: June 15, 2016Date of Patent: August 4, 2020Assignee: DENSO CORPORATIONInventors: Hitoshi Hoshino, Yuji Kitamura, Soju Matsumoto

Publication number: 20110056560Abstract: Reduction in characteristic due to non-uniformity of crystallinity of a microcrystalline silicon film in a surface of a solar cell module is inhibited. A solar cell module is provided having an i-type layer of a microcrystalline silicon film as a photovoltaic layer in a photovoltaic unit (14), the i-type layer has a first region (30) and a second region (32) having a lower crystallization percentage than the first region (30) in the surface, and a tab electrode (22) to a terminal box (24) of the solar cell module (100) is formed overlapping the second region (32).Type: ApplicationFiled: September 3, 2010Publication date: March 10, 2011Applicant: SANYO ELECTRIC CO., LTD.Inventors: Yuji Kitamura, Kazuya Murata, Hirotaka Katayama

Publication number: 20070037911Abstract: The present invention provides an adhesive composition exhibiting a great adhesive strength between an adherend and an adhesive composition and providing remarkably improved workability in attaching a sheet of an unvulcanized rubber composition by forming a hardened surface of an adhesive layer comprising the adhesive composition and a process for adhesion using the adhesive. The adhesive composition comprises a conjugated diene-based polymer (A) having at least one functional group having a photo-curable unsaturated hydrocarbon group at a chain end, a polymerizable compound (B), a photopolymerization initiator (C) and at least one of an active energy ray-shielding agent (D1) and a metal and/or metal compound (D2).Type: ApplicationFiled: August 9, 2006Publication date: February 15, 2007Inventors: Shinichiro Sugi, Emil Giza, Yuji Kitamura, Kenji Sato

Publication number: 20050258232Abstract: A plurality of items is tracked using a distributed network of gates, each having a gate-identification. Each item is provided with an identifier for specifying an item-identification of the item and a tracking-station-identification of a tracking station related to the item. Whenever one of the items approaches one of the gates, the item-identification of that item and the tracking-station-identification of the tracking station related to the item are obtained from the identifier of the item via that gate. The item-identification of the item and the gate-identification of the gate are then communicated to the tracking station identified by the tracking-station-identification obtained from the identifier of the item such that the item can be tracked as it moves amongst the gates.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 30, 2005Publication date: November 24, 2005Inventor: Yuji Kitamura

Patent number: 6795382Abstract: A continuity maintaining part restarts recording of data onto the optical disk after pause of recording occurring due to buffer under-run, in such a manner that continuity with information recorded immediately before the occurrence of the pause occurred is maintained. A counting part counts the number of times of operation of the continuity maintaining part during the recording of the information onto the optical disk. A display part displays the number of times of operation of the continuity maintaining part counted by the counting part.Type: GrantFiled: August 1, 2001Date of Patent: September 21, 2004Assignee: Ricoh Company, Ltd.Inventors: Yuji Kitamura, Kazuhiko Hosokawa, Tomomi Ueno
